This research was conducted to estimate the amount of microbial protein synthesis in Iranian buffaloes' rumen. Four male swamp buffaloes with average live body weight of 140±10 kg were used in this study. Four diets of 0 (control diet, 100% forage), 15, 30 and 45% concentrate in a 4 × 4 Latin Square were tested. The results indicated that by increasing the concentrate level in the diet of swamp buffaloes. the amount of purine derivatives (PD) excreted in urine. The amount of allantoin excreted in urine increased by increasing concentrate level form 0 to 45% (13.2 and 21.8 mmol/day; P0.01).
